Overview

Lizzie McGuire has graduated from middle school and takes a trip to Rome, Italy with her class. And what was supposed to be only a normal trip, becomes a teenager's dream come true.

Detailed Bias Analysis

Analyzing...
Center

Primary

The film's central narrative revolves around universal themes of self-discovery, friendship, and honesty, focusing on individual growth and personal integrity rather than engaging with specific political ideologies or societal critiques.

The movie features visible diversity within its cast, incorporating characters from various backgrounds without explicitly recasting traditionally white roles. Its narrative maintains a neutral or positive framing of traditional identities, focusing on universal coming-of-age themes rather than explicit critiques or DEI-centric storylines.

Secondary

The Lizzie McGuire Movie does not feature any identifiable LGBTQ+ characters or themes. The narrative is entirely focused on heterosexual relationships and friendships, resulting in no portrayal of queer identity within the film.

The Lizzie McGuire Movie does not feature any transsexual characters or explore related themes. The film's plot centers on a high school graduate's trip to Rome and a case of mistaken identity, with no elements pertaining to transgender identity present.

The film is a teen comedy focused on personal growth and social challenges, not physical conflict. There are no scenes depicting female characters engaging in or winning close-quarters physical combat against male opponents.

The Lizzie McGuire Movie is a continuation of the TV series, with all established characters retaining their original genders. No characters from the source material or previous installments were portrayed as a different gender in the film.

All returning characters from the original series are portrayed by the same actors, maintaining their established races. No new portrayals of existing characters constitute a race swap.
